I was wondering how legal is it to get the Winch. Any minor modification seems to trigger the RTO. And winch would be against the pedestrian safety norms. So how feasible is it to get it added.

Hope we can get some of these right out of factory iself.
Changing the bumper to an offroad bumper is an offence as per new traffic laws, it amounts to a challan of 5000/- Inr in delhi under the RC violation head.
